Job offer was not the same as posted in Dev**

I applied to a job as Director of Rehabilitations for a new Center in Al Ain. The job was posted in Dev**; being an expert in special education and developmental disabilities with more than 10 years experience in the field, they contacted me back as soon as I sent my resume. The consultant recruiter set several Skype interviews so I could learm about the job and they could see if my qualifications were a good fit for the organization.
Everything went fine until I got there for the in person interview.
This recruiter consultant picked me up at the airport in Dubai and on the way to Al Ain he started to get fresh with me in the car trying to hold my hand and asking me personal questions. Fortunately he did not insist after I told him I was not confortable with that kind of treatment. I assured him that I have gone to Al Ain for business purpose and I was not looking to get involved in personal relationships while I was there. Once we were negotiating the place where I would live, he suggested I should live with him. This really bothered me and I told him that his behavior and invitations of personal nature were totally inappropriate.
Once I interviewed with the Executive Director of the place, who was very nice and professional. He requested the consultant to give me an offer. After reading the offer, I found that the salary had been reduced by 1500 US dollars per month. In addition, the transportation, accomodations, vacations time and airlines tickets have also been changed to less that what was posted in Devex.
For those to you in the UAE, what is the medium salary for a Directors position with about 50 direct reports to manage and train. I am still interested in the job but I am not getting anywhere with this consultant, he has been absolutely unprofessional and because I did not accept his advances, I believe he will not be very cooperative.
In addition, he has refuse to give me the email of the Executive Director and I would like to negotiate terms directly with him. What can I do? Please anyone can give me some feedback on how should I handle this situation?
